Karnataka Minister Orders Strict Guidelines at Dubare Elephant Camp After Tourist’s Death

Karnataka Minister for Minor Irrigation, Science and Technology, and Madikeri District In-charge Minister N.S. Boseraju has instructed the Madikeri district administration to enforce guidelines at the Dubare Elephant Camp following the tragic death of a woman tourist during a clash between captive elephants. Expressing deep sorrow over the incident, the Minister has sought a comprehensive report on the incident’s cause and any lapses in tourist guideline management.

In light of the incident, the Minister emphasized the importance of implementing strict safety guidelines at the camp to ensure tourist safety. He urged officials and staff to ensure the mandatory adherence to these guidelines and advised the district administration to take necessary precautionary measures. The Minister highlighted the unpredictability of wild animals’ behavior and urged visitors to strictly follow instructions issued by the Forest Department for their safety.

The tragic incident occurred when a woman tourist from Tamil Nadu lost her life after being caught in a clash between two captive elephants at the Dubare Elephant Camp in Madikeri district. The victim, identified as 33-year-old S. Juneshe, was fatally injured by one of the elephants during the altercation, while her husband sustained severe injuries and was hospitalized for treatment. The couple had been at the camp participating in activities with the elephants when the unfortunate incident took place.
